In the UK the Royal Institute of British Architects (RIBA) is the professional body for architects. In addition to laying out effective training for budding architects, RIBA also provides advice and information on the work and ethical code that all architects must observe to give you the best possible service. It will take 5 years of full time study and at least two years hands on experience before a trainee can register as an architect with the Architects Registration Board and apply for RIBA membership. Architects Fees - The fees demanded by architects are normally based on a rate per unit area of the construction, a percentage of the development costs, an hourly rate or a fixed fee. Or, possibly a mix of these fee structures may be used. Typically, residential projects incur architect's fees of around twelve to twenty percent of the total construction cost, while renovation projects can attract even steeper charges at fifteen to twenty percent. For commercial projects a significantly lower percentage of between 4% and 12% will be charged in architect's fees.

Architect or Interior Designer? - We've often been asked "what's the difference between an interior designer and an architect"? The answer to this question varies according to who you're asking, and for some folks the distinction is crystal clear, while for others the two occupations intersect and merge on many levels. Generally speaking, architects work on the overall design of a building with regards to the shape - the outer shell, the external walls and the roof, while the primary focus of interior designers is the internal finish - the wall finishes, the floor surfaces and the furnishings. To confuse things even further, there are also 'interior architectural designers', who largely deal with a building's internal structure - the spatial planning, the thermal qualities and the flow of internal space, but still need to be properly qualified. Providing the expertise, knowledge and skills necessary at every stage of the design and construction process, an architect will be needed by any individual who is aiming to construct a new home in Bewdley, regardless of whether it is new build or self-build. They can help with every area of creating a unique new house in Bewdley, including construction inspection, building regulations, planning permission applications and contractor selection.

They will firstly produce a project brief to outline your exact needs, including technical specifications, budget, spatial requirements and build site. They'll offer you an array of design options in accordance with the brief, which you should be able to view in 3D architectural visualisation. If required, project management services will be provided by most Bewdley architects, managing every step of the building process from design and planning to its final completion.
